WebOct 9, 2000 · Students invite a local newspaper reporter to speak to the class and write a newspaper-style article about the visit. (Grades 3-5, 6-8, 9-12) Front Page News. Students compare and contrast front-page stories from two local or state newspapers. (Grades 6-8, 9-12) Editorial Cartoons. Students create editorial cartoons about topics in the news.
